1. Upgrade to High-End Speakers 

Many people think there’s no difference between lower-quality and high-end speakers. However, there’s a large and noticeable difference that you only need to hear to recognize instantly! Once you’ve enjoyed powerful bass notes and intricate, detailed sound, it’s nearly impossible to go back to low-end speakers. 

Deck out your room with surround sound for both music and movie enjoyment. We recommend high-tier brands like Origin Acoustics, JL Audio, and Triad Speakers. Want less clutter? Origin Acoustics manufactures high-fidelity speakers that can blend seamlessly into walls and ceilings. 

2. Swap Your HD TV for 4K or 8K 

Whether you want a display over the bar or across the room, it’s time to make the upgrade to 4K or even 8K. You’ll enjoy deeper blacks, richer colors, and clearer visuals than ever when you switch to a Samsung QLED or Sony OLED TV. What does OLED mean? It means that every pixel is self-illuminating, resulting in superior color accuracy.

3. Try a Split Screen Feature 

Create your own sports bar at home by splitting your large display into halves or quadrants – or play different feeds across several screens. If you own a smart control system like Control4, Crestron, or Savant, you can easily divide television screens to play multiple games at once. Smart remotes make it simple to select media and choose a screen to play on. You’ll never flip back and forth between games again!

4. Set the Scene with Smart Lighting 

Entertainment is only one key to creating a fun atmosphere. If you want to use your home bar or media room more often, you can create a welcoming ambiance with color customizable smart lighting. 

A smart lighting system gives you total control of your lights’ brightness and hue. You can save custom scenes like “Party” or “Movie Night” that will set the lights just how you like them – all from a single tap on a wall keypad or swipe on your phone. 

5. Control It All from One System 

If you want to spend more time in the room, you need to make it easy to use. A home control system like Control4, Crestron, or Savant automates everything you need – the TV, speakers, lights, and even motorized shades and thermostats. Then, you can make the whole room ready to entertain from the same remote or app.
